What is the Axis Syllabus?

The Axis Syllabus is an extensive resource that provides crucial insights into training, preparation, and performance for movers. It incorporates knowledge from various disciplines regarding flexibility, strength, alignment, and injury prevention. This information empowers teachers and practitioners to enhance their movement choices and explore efficiency and safe risk-taking.

Common applications include:

  • Climbing
  • Horseback riding
  • Construction
  • Sports
  • Dance
  • Running

About Kathleen Rea:

Kathleen danced with leading companies including Canada’s Ballet Jorgen and National Ballet of Canada. With 22 years of experience in contact improvisation, she has created over 40 dance works and received multiple DORA nominations. As an advocate for neurodiversity, she shares crucial insights on consent culture in the dance community.
